Detailed Description
The following description will further describe embodiments of the present invention with reference to the accompanying drawings and examples. The following examples are only for illustrating the technical solutions of the present invention more clearly, and the protection scope of the present invention is not limited thereby.
The utility model discloses the technical scheme who specifically implements is:
as shown in fig. 1 and 2, a mobile grain winnowing machine includes a winnowing machine main body 1, and a moving plate 2 disposed at the bottom of the winnowing machine main body 1;
mounting frames are respectively arranged at four corners of the bottom surface of the movable plate 2, and a traveling wheel 3 is mounted on each mounting frame;
the two ends of the moving plate 2 extend outwards to form convex parts 4 respectively, two supporting devices are arranged on the two convex parts 4 respectively and comprise a lifting plate 5, a screw rod 6 and a chain wheel 7, the lifting plate 5 is positioned above the convex parts 4, the bottom surface of the lifting plate 5 is provided with a pair of supporting columns 8, the lower end of each supporting column 8 penetrates through the convex parts 4 and is provided with a supporting plate 9, the convex parts 4 are provided with through holes for the supporting columns 8 to penetrate through, the screw rod 6 is rotatably connected to the top surfaces of the convex parts 4 through bearings, the upper end of the screw rod 6 penetrates through the lifting plate 5, the lower end of the screw rod 5 extends to the lower part of the convex parts 4 and is provided with the chain wheel 7, the lifting plate 5 is provided with threaded holes for the screw rod 6 to penetrate through and is in threaded connection with the screw rod 6, the chain wheels 7 of the two supporting devices are connected through a transmission chain, the bottom surface of one convex part 4, a lifting driving motor 10 is installed in the installation groove, a driving gear 11 is arranged on an output shaft of the lifting driving motor 10, and a driven gear 12 meshed with the driving gear 11 is arranged on the screw rod 6.
The bottom surface of the support plate 9 is provided with a cushion pad 13.
The mounting frame comprises a top plate 14 and a pair of side plates 15, a wheel shaft 16 penetrates through the travelling wheel 3, and two ends of the wheel shaft 16 are respectively connected with the pair of side plates 15 in a rotating mode through bearings.
And a guide sliding sleeve sleeved on the support column 8 is arranged in the through hole.
The upper end of the screw rod 6 is provided with a hand wheel 17.
The utility model has the advantages and the beneficial effects that: the utility model provides a portable grain air separator, its is rational in infrastructure, conveniently removes and carries to through setting up strutting arrangement, can support fixedly to removing the air separator that targets in place, avoid the air separator to take place to shift at the during operation.
Through setting up the movable plate 2 to set up walking wheel 3 in the bottom surface of movable plate 2, made things convenient for the removal and the transport of air separator, thereby improved air separator's practicality. When the winnowing machine moves in place, the lifting driving motor 10 is started to rotate positively, the lifting driving motor 10 drives one of the screw rods 6 to rotate through the meshing of the driving gear 11 and the driven gear 12, the chain wheels 7 of the two screw rods 6 are connected through the transmission chain, so the other screw rod 6 rotates together, the screw rods 6 drive the lifting plate 5 and the supporting plate 9 connected with the lifting plate 5 to move downwards after rotating, the lifting driving motor 10 stops running when the lifting plate 5 moves downwards to be attached to the bulge part 4, the cushion pads 13 on the bottom surface of the supporting plate 9 are in contact with the ground at the moment, and the walking wheels 3 are separated from the ground, so that the effect of supporting and fixing the winnowing machine is achieved, and the influence on the normal work of the winnowing machine caused by displacement. When the winnowing machine needs to be moved, the lifting driving motor 10 is started to rotate reversely, so that the lifting plate 5 and the supporting plate 9 move upwards until the walking wheels 3 contact the ground, and the winnowing machine can be moved.
